WebFeb 12, 2024 · 1 Answer. You can just do getByText ('test table data') without asserting anything. getByText will fail your test if it cannot find the text it is looking for. If the text is there and your test passes, you essentially asserted that it is there even if you haven't used expect () assertion explicitly. Though be careful when using queryByText (or ... WebMay 4, 2024 · So make sure that App.test.js is open and hit the Run button in the debugging panel on the left. We set a breakpoint in the onChange handler in the WeekdaySelect component. Note: If you set the breakpoint first and then run the test the breakpoint might jump to another place. Just remove it and set it again.
